智能合约是存储在区块链上的自执行合约,合约条款直接写入代码中。它们允许自动执行和验证合约条款,无需第三方参与。智能合约的透明性和不可篡改性,降低了欺诈行为的风险,并提供了更高的效率。尽管如此,安全性仍然是一个值得关注的问题,因为错误的代码可能会导致数字资产被盗或者合约被错误执行。
### TPWallet简介TPWallet是一款多链数字资产钱包,支持Ethereum、EOS、TRON等多个区块链平台。用户可以在TPWallet中存储不同类型的数字货币进行交易、投资和管理。TPWallet以其用户友好界面和强大的功能设计,为用户提供简单、安全的数字资产管理体验。不仅如此,TPWallet还提供了对于智能合约的支持,允许用户与去中心化应用(DApp)进行交互。
### 如何在TPWallet上确认合约的真假?在TPWallet上确认合约的真假主要可以通过以下几个步骤进行:
#### 1. 检查合约地址首先,用户应当获得合约的地址,确保该地址是从可信的来源获取的。一些项目会在其官方网站或社交媒体上发布合约地址,而非通过第三方网站或不明渠道。用户可以通过在以太坊区块链浏览器(如Etherscan)上查询合约地址,从而查看该合约的创建者及其交易历史,以确认其合法性。
#### 2. 分析合约代码如果用户有一定的技术背景,他们可以查看合约代码。许多知名和可信的合约会将其代码公开,使得用户能够进行审计。合约代码的质量直接影响合约的安全性。如果合约代码存在明显的漏洞或不合理的设计,则可能是恶意合约的迹象。此外,用户也可以寻找已经通过知名的安全审计公司的合约,这类合约通常更可信。
#### 3. 查阅相关评价和社区反馈社区的反馈往往具有重要参考价值。在TPWallet的社区论坛或社交媒体上,用户可以查找他人对该合约的讨论和评价。尤其是一些著名的加密货币社区如Reddit、Telegram等,它们都可能提供实用的信息和警告。此外,一些用户会分享自己与合约交互后的经历,这也能帮助新用户作出判断。
#### 4. 使用合约验证工具市面上存在一些合约验证工具,这些工具能够帮助用户更直观地了解合约的安全性。例如,某些在线平台能够对合约代码进行分析,并提供评分或风险评估。用户可以利用这些工具对其有疑虑的合约进行检查,以便获得更专业的意见和建议。
#### 5. 寻找第三方评估一些专业的区块链或加密货币新闻网站会对新的智能合约进行评估,提供独立的第三方反馈。这类评估通常综合考量合约团队的背景、技术实现、潜在风险等多个因素,能够有效帮助用户判断合约的真实性和可靠性。
### 如何精确识别合约骗局? #### 1. 获取必要的合约信息在决定与一个合约进行交互之前,用户应收集完整的信息,包括合约的目标、团队成员、发展路线图等。通常,欺诈性的合约会在短时间内推出,没有任何详细的白皮书或合约信息。这可能是他们意图通过短暂的市场波动来获利的策略。
#### 2. 关注项目团队背景一个可靠的项目通常会有一支透明且经验丰富的团队。用户可以通过项目的官网了解团队成员的背景和经历,以判断其是否具备相关的技术能力和行业信誉。相反,如果团队信息模糊甚至完全匿名,就要提高警惕,特别是在资金的投入上。
#### 3. 评估合约的透明度透明度是衡量合约可信度的重要指标。用户应仔细考量合约的代码是否开源,以及是否接受外部审计。一个高透明度的合约会主动向用户展示其代码并允许外部进行审查。而没有透明度的合约,往往是害怕被揭示其安全隐患的表现。
#### 4. 查看社区反馈社区的反响对用户判断合约的真实性至关重要。用户在TPWallet或其他相关社交平台中寻找项目的讨论。若发现大量负面评论,或者多个用户警告该合约存在问题,那就应当立即停止与该合约的交互。反之,普遍的正面反馈则可能意味着该合约相对可靠。
#### 5. 设定投资上限即使经过多方面的验证,仍然存在风险的可能性。在与任何合约进行交互之前,用户应当设定合理的投资上限,仅投入一部分资金到尚不熟悉的合约中。此做法能够有效降低潜在的损失风险,保证用户的资产安全。
### 哪些合约更容易被认为是骗局? #### 1. 高回报承诺的合约这些合约通常承诺高额的回报,超出常规投资的回报水平。用户应特别警惕那些声称“没有风险”、“轻松赚钱”的合约,这些往往是庞氏骗局的典型特征,前期的高回报主要依赖于后来投资者的资金,而非实际的业务收入。
#### 2. 隐藏团队信息的合约在投资之前,透明的团队信息是一个重要的风险评估指标。如果一个项目团队信息模糊或者不愿意公开他们的身份,那么这个合约就需要谨慎对待。很多成功的项目都会在官方网站上介绍团队成员的简介和背景,以增强用户的信任。
#### 3. 缺乏完整文档的合约合约通常伴随有白皮书等说明文件,解释其目的、功能以及技术实现。如果一个合约缺乏相关的文档,其合法性就值得怀疑。用户应要求项目方提供详细的技术白皮书、商业计划书等信息,以充分了解该项目的可行性和运营模式。
#### 4. 激励机制不合理的合约一些合约设置了复杂的收益分配机制,且难以理解,其背后可能隐藏着欺诈行为。真实的项目通常会有透明合理的激励机制,并能够清晰解释其收益模式。如果激励机制造得复杂不清,用户应保持谨慎,并进一步调查其真正目的。
#### 5. 缺少社区支持的合约许多成功的加密货币项目都建立在强大的社区支持之上。如果某个合约在社交媒体上几乎没有讨论,或者存在大量负面反馈,则很可能是一个骗局。用户应注意评估社区的整体反响和反馈,全面了解合约的真实情况。
### 什么是合约的审计? #### 1. 合约审计的重要性合约审计是对智能合约的代码和逻辑进行系统性的检查和分析,以找出潜在的漏洞和安全隐患。由于智能合约一旦部署在区块链上就无法更改,因此提前的审计至关重要。审计能够及时发现代码中的瑕疵,减少用户的风险,并提升投资者的信任度。
#### 2. 如何选择审计公司?选择合适的审计公司是确保合约安全的重要一步。用户应查看审计公司的信誉、历史案例和客户反馈等信息。知名的审计公司通常会具备丰富的技术背景,并对合约进行详细的分析和“白盒测试”,以确保代码的安全性和可行性。
#### 3. 审计报告的解读通过审计后,审计公司会提供详细的审计报告。用户应仔细阅读报告中的每一项内容,特别是安全漏洞和建议的修复措施。报告通常会对合约的风险进行评估,并提供改善的建议。用户应关注是否有重大的安全问题,确保在与合约交互之前修复所有已识别的漏洞。
#### 4. 审计后的持续监测合约审计不应视为一个一次性的过程。随着技术的更新和市场的变化,合约安全性方面始终存在潜在风险。因此,用户还应关注合约运营期间的行为变化,保持对合约安全性的持续监测,必要时进行再审计。
#### 5. 审计报告的公众透明性一些高信誉的项目会将审计报告公开,供社区用户自由查阅。这种透明性有助于建立用户与项目方之间的信任关系,降低用户的风险感。用户在选择合约时,应优先考虑那些能够提供公开并透明审计报告的项目。
### 如何防范安全隐患? #### 1. 安装安全软件在使用TPWallet或其他与区块链相关的服务时,应安装防火墙、反病毒软件等安全工具。这些软件能够有效防止潜在的网络攻击,保护用户的隐私以及资产安全。
#### 2. 定期更新软件和设备保持软件和设备的更新,能够降低被攻击的风险。开发者通常会发布安全补丁,以修补程序的漏洞,因此用户应定期检查并进行更新,确保系统处于最佳安全状态。
#### 3. 使用强密码和双重身份验证强密码和双重身份验证能大大增强账户安全性,防止未授权访问。用户应设置由字母、数字和特殊符号组成的复杂密码,并启用二次验证功能,以额外保障账户的安全。
#### 4. 教育和培训定期参与网络安全培训和教育,能够提高用户的安全意识。了解网络骗局的常见特点和安全窍门,将有助于用户在日常使用中有效规避潜在隐患。
#### 5. 分散投资用户在参与合约时,应分散投资到不同的项目中。这样不仅降低了潜在损失,还可以通过多样化投资来平衡整体风险。即使某个合约出现问题,用户也不会受到过大影响。
### 结论 在TPWallet上确认合约的真假不是一项简单的任务,但通过系统性的方法,用户可以大幅降低参与诈骗或恶意合约的风险。了解合约的基础知识、项目背景以及认真审查社区反馈,都是确保安全的关键步骤。随着加密资产市场的发展,用户需时刻保持警惕,主动学习与适应,以便能够更好地保障自己的数字资产安全。
leave a reply